Аудит БД, оптимизация SQL запросов, чистка таблиц, индексов, ключей WP
Суть проекта - ускорить работу сайта
думаю так, ускорить сайт можно тремя путями:
1) вычистить от неиспользуемых таблиц и ключей БД, оптимизировать (например перевести таблицы в InnoDB) БД, оптимизировать кол-во селектов для построения страницы
2) переделать бэк и вместо ACF использовать более подходящий плагин для листинга
3) оптимизировать фронт.
поэтому начинаю с п.1.
по задаче ожидаю, что исполнитель
1. проверит все ключи используемые в шаблоне, таблицы, зачистит неиспользуемые.
2. проверит все selectы при построении страницы категории и поста, оптимизирует существующие, удалит дублированные или вынесет экспертную резолюцию, что select ы не подлежат оптимизации и надо переделывать бэк.
ставки и предложения к проекту буду рассматривать, если будет понятно почему вашу заявку на проект я должен рассмотреть. Например "готов помочь" и "готов выполнить" - непонятно почему нужно рассматривать вашу кандидатуру. Мое имхо, потоковые биды на проекты, ведет к потоковому выполнению проекта, что не подходит для меня.
Дополнительные вопросы приветствуются, отвечу или в обсуждении к проекту, или в личных сообщениях.
подробнее
страницы формируются на сайте очень долго, особенность в том, что много где используются ACF, каждое значение которого формирует запрос к БД.
в итоге имеем на формирование
страницы категории более 400 запросов по query monitor и более 2 секунд для генерации страницы
поста более 100 запросов по query monitor и более 2 секунд для генерации страницы.
это с включенным w3 total cache
вот например главная страница сайта
а вот например вот например wp_posts
постов на сайте до 150, а в таблице http://prntscr.com/vfioaf
сайт двуязычный рус/укр - построено при помощи wpml, но перед этим двуязычность была построена на qtranslate x.
на qtranslate были созданы все страницы, но qtranslate работал с багами, поэтому переделали все под wpml. в связи с этим и связываю засоренность БД, плюс тестировались разные плагины и тоже БД не чистилась.
Current freelance projects in the category Databases & SQL
Eliminate the issue of incomplete data import from Excel files of Nova Poshta specifications into 1C:
45 USD
Goal: There is a processing in 1C for uploading the specifications of Nova Poshta. For unclear reasons, it has stopped loading some tabular data. We need to find the reason and eliminate the problem of incomplete data import from Excel files of Nova Poshta specifications into… System & Network Administration, Databases & SQL ∙ 21 hours 37 minutes back ∙ 14 proposals |
Accounting, planning, and sales system for a mushroom farm
601 USD
Here is the complete, final text of the Technical Assignment (TA). It combines all your requirements: 16 chambers, 20 contractors, a schedule by days, accounting for containers, profitability calculation, and a mandatory division into three grades of mushrooms. You can fully… Databases & SQL, Client Management & CRM ∙ 3 days 1 hour back ∙ 55 proposals |
External report 1C 8.3 — forecast of goods balances
22 USD
An external report (.erf) is needed for 1C:Enterprise 8.3 (configuration to be specified). What it should do: Extract product balances from the database Analyze sales history for the last 30 days Calculate the average sales rate for each product Determine how many days until the… Databases & SQL, Client Management & CRM ∙ 3 days 2 hours back ∙ 13 proposals |
Web Application & Database Security Audit for Custom CRM — BaaS / Database-as-API Specialist (PenetrProject Overview We operate a custom-built customer relationship management (CRM) platform that runs two service businesses on a single system. It is a modern JavaScript web application backed by a backend-as-a-service (BaaS) database and deployed on a serverless hosting… Databases & SQL, Testing & QA ∙ 3 days 14 hours back ∙ 10 proposals |
Database synchronizationSynchronization of Microsoft Access programs and CRM SalesDrive. Data transfer from CRM to Microsoft Access in the first stage (changing the funnel status). Data transfer from Microsoft Access to CRM in the second stage (changing the status in the program). Databases & SQL ∙ 3 days 20 hours back ∙ 12 proposals |
